Lee Group’s scope covered the full perimeter and access control fencing requirements of the facility. Works included the installation of PAS68-rated Palisade fencing as the primary perimeter barrier, a crash-rated solution engineered to provide robust protection against high-impact vehicle threats. Access points were secured with a suite of advanced gate systems including PAS-rated sliding gates, swing gates, rising arm barriers, DEFCON 358 finger-proof mesh fencing and gates, and chain link swing gates, each specified and configured to meet the site’s particular security zoning requirements.
PAS68 is the benchmark standard for hostile vehicle mitigation in high-security environments. A PAS68-rated installation is independently tested and certified to withstand vehicle impacts at defined speeds and weights, making it the appropriate specification for facilities where vehicle-borne threats are a credible risk. For a cloud computing and AI infrastructure site, where physical breach carries consequences well beyond the site boundary, a crash-rated perimeter was the only appropriate starting point.
Lee Group’s installation of PAS68-rated Palisade fencing delivers that level of certified protection while maintaining the clean, upright profile appropriate for a modern technology facility.
Perimeter fencing is only as effective as the access points within it. Lee Group installed a layered access control fencing solution across the facility, with each gate type selected to match the traffic profile and security classification of its location. PAS-rated sliding and swing gates handle primary vehicle access with the same crash-rated performance as the perimeter fencing. Rising arm barriers control vehicle flow at secondary access points. DEFCON 358 finger-proof mesh fencing and gates secure pedestrian zones and internal boundaries where anti-climb and anti-cut performance is required. Chain link swing gates cover lower-security utility access points, completing a fully integrated perimeter system.
